Overview of noun attendant

The noun attendant has 3 senses


  • attendant, attender, tender -- (someone who waits on or tends to or attends to the needs of another)

  • attendant, attender, attendee, meeter -- (a person who is present and participates in a meeting; "he was a regular attender at department meetings"; "the gathering satisfied both organizers and attendees")

  • accompaniment, concomitant, attendant, co-occurrence -- (an event or situation that happens at the same time as or in connection with another)


Overview of adj attendant

The adj attendant has 2 senses


  • attendant -- (being present (at meeting or event etc.) "attendant members of the congreation")

  • attendant, consequent, accompanying, concomitant, incidental, ensuant, resultant, sequent -- (following or accompanying as a consequence; "an excessive growth of bureaucracy, with attendant problems"; "snags incidental to the changeover in management"; "attendant circumstances"; "the period of tension and consequent need for military preparedness"; "the ensuant response to his appeal"; "the resultant savings were considerable")
